Output 962579561e39cb717f431c93a2943b54286b6c868cede2f30a2efdbac20abeb7:1

value
1896252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6d7858ff74325e338fe449c4312036b8d65c9e9 OP_EQUAL
address
3KpPuEn71J6sEDQRftYkPtqwCTmaSFmakD
transaction
962579561e39cb717f431c93a2943b54286b6c868cede2f30a2efdbac20abeb7
confirmations
287866
spent
true